HTML表单中的from属性有哪些?它们各自的作用是什么?
游客
2025-06-07 10:38:01
2
开篇:深入理解HTML表单元素
在网页开发过程中,HTML表单是收集用户输入数据的重要元素。一个表单通常由一个或多个输入控件组成,如文本框、复选框、单选按钮等。HTML中的`
```
method属性
`method`属性定义了表单提交数据到服务器时所使用的HTTP方法,通常有`GET`和`POST`两种方式。`GET`方法会将数据附加在URL中,适用于查询等小型数据提交;`POST`方法则将数据作为HTTP请求的内容体发送,适用于大量数据提交。
```html
```
target属性
`target`属性指定如何在浏览器中打开action属性指向的URL。其值可以是`_self`(当前窗口,默认值)、`_blank`(新窗口)、`_parent`(父窗口)、`_top`(顶层窗口)等。
```html
```
enctype属性
`enctype`属性定义表单提交时内容的编码类型。当`method`属性为`POST`时,此属性尤为重要。常用值包括`application/x-www-form-urlencoded`(默认)、`multipart/form-data`(文件上传时使用)、`text/plain`等。
```html
```
form标签的高级属性
novalidate属性
`novalidate`属性用于取消浏览器的自动验证,使得表单在提交时不会进行HTML5的验证机制。
```html
```
autocomplete属性
`autocomplete`属性指示浏览器是否可以自动完成表单输入。其值有`on`(允许自动完成)和`off`(关闭自动完成)。
```html
```
accept-charset属性
`accept-charset`属性指定了表单数据提交时使用的字符编码集。默认情况下,浏览器将使用与页面相同的字符编码。
```html
```
实用技巧和常见问题
实用技巧
1.利用`form`标签的`action`和`method`属性,可以灵活地控制表单数据提交的目标和方式。
2.在处理文件上传时,务必使用`enctype="multipart/form-data"`。
3.对于敏感数据,使用`method="post"`并配合HTTPS协议,可以提高数据传输的安全性。
常见问题
1.表单数据提交后页面跳转问题:可以通过`target`属性控制表单提交后的页面行为。
2.表单数据编码问题:正确使用`enctype`属性,确保数据格式符合服务器端接收的要求。
3.表单验证问题:利用HTML5的表单验证属性或JavaScript来增强用户体验,并对数据进行前端验证。
结语
通过本文的学习,相信你已经对HTML中的`
- 搜索
- 最新文章
- 热门文章
-
- 怎样快速搜索关键词并找到相关网站?
- 关键词配合视频的网站叫什么?如何进行关键词视频优化?
- 谷歌加速优化如何关闭?关闭谷歌加速优化的正确方法是什么?
- 小网站英文关键词应该搜什么?
- 英文网站关键词设置的要点有哪些?
- 如何选择合适的搜索关键词网站?
- SEO网站优化有哪些有效方法?
- 搜索什么关键词能找到成人内容网站?
- 谷歌优化公司面试怎么样?面试流程是怎样的?
- 谷歌优化技术是什么?如何有效提升网站排名?
- 网站搜索优化方案怎么写?有哪些要点?
- 网站热点关键词怎么查找?有哪些工具和方法可以查找热点关键词?
- 如何撰写一份有效的网站优化推广方案?
- 谷歌优化师业绩如何计算?
- 网站搜索关键词怎么设置?如何设置网站以优化搜索关键词?
- 优化网站时关键词的作用是什么?
- 关键词布局和优化应如何进行?
- 网站SEO关键词分析的正确方法是什么?
- 网站都搜什么关键词?如何分析竞争对手关键词?
- 如何实现谷歌优化的最佳效果?
- 热门tag